Description:

Ovarro is a company with real purpose. Our RTUs and SCADA have underpinned critical infrastructure for over 40 years and our leak detection portfolio is helping to drive towards a global sustainable future. To enable this we need team members who fully live our OneTeam value which is at the heart of everything we do at Ovarro. Our new Manufacturing Engineer will support production with process definition, routing, takt timing and production flow – ensuring line balancing as appropriate with regular reviews

Key Responsibilities:

  • Attend NPI project meetings to assess production impact and advanced planning
  • Drive continuous improvements in productivity to maintain and improve COG’s
  • Work closely with purchasing on ensuring right sources of material, at the right quality and cost
  • Working closely with suppliers to ensure components are designed and manufactured to the correct specification and quality requirements
  • Work closely with the Site Production Manager on efficient production planning processes
  • Manage production ECN, run in and run out of materials and process

Required skills and experience

  • Experienced Manufacturing engineer with an electrical/electronic experience, PCBA and Box building knowledge would be a distinct advantage including management of production test equipment
  • Understands technical drawings and Design for Manufacture including DFMEA, Control Plans and SOP’s
  • Able to translate engineering drawings into easy to understand and use production information
  • Line balancing skills, including process flow analysis and takt time planning, 5S
  • Experience of leading VAVE activities for both process and purchasing improvements
  • Strong problem solving skills, use of RA and CA, 5Y, 8D
